What Does Final Expense Insurance Insure?
Burial insurance covers your funeral expenses as you may have guessed from the name. This consists of obvious things like buying your final resting place, purchasing the coffin (or cremation costs), paying for your own funeral service, and purchasing a headstone.
Other lesser known prices that can frequently be covered are things like grave digging and floral arrangements. They can add up fast, although they’re not considerable on their very own.
For an unprepared family who might not get a lot of disposable income, these prices (which could run into the tens of thousands of dollars) can be quite a jolt. Many families turn to get loans, being in debt to pay the funeral expenses of a family member isn’t a pleasant feeling off. Especially when you are striving to grieve.

Prices for burial insurance plans differ drastically between providers. Some basic coverage strategies can begin from just a couple of dollars a week, but there are highly comprehensive strategies that cost more.
Nevertheless as you can imagine, better coverage demands higher fees.
Most payments are created monthly, but there are a few strategies that take weekly payments too.
The amount you have to pay is mainly determined by your age. The older you are, the more your premiums are going to be. Should you be mathematically closer to passing, you’re likely to need to cover more over a shorter quantity of time, it’s simple economics really. Because of their lifespans that are statistically shorter, guys tend to pay more for final expense insurance than girls.
This really is one of the reasons that a lot of people strongly counsel which you take burial insurance out early on.

Your health also plays a large part in your premiums. If you’ve got a history of serious health issues, your premium will probably be higher. It is useful to realize that different insurance companies have various standards. Therefore, if you do have health problems, it is worth it to search around.
